Brief Title: A Study to Evaluate the Effect of Volanesorsen on Cardiac Repolarization Conducted in Healthy Volunteers
Sponsor: Ionis Pharmaceuticals, Inc.

Official Title: A Randomized, Placebo-Controlled, Four-Period Crossover, Study to Evaluate the Effect of Volanesorsen on the QTc Interval Using a Therapeutic and Supra-Therapeutic Dose Compared With Placebo in Healthy Volunteers: a Thorough QT Study

Brief Summary: The primary objective of this study is to assess the corrected QT interval (QTc) effect of volanesorsen (ISIS 304801) administered as a 300 mg subcutaneous (SC) therapeutic and a 300 mg intravenous (IV; 2-hour infusion) supra-therapeutic dose relative to placebo in healthy adult male and female subjects.
